Smiling Child 2024 Impact Metrics
Our 2024 Smiling Child funding is now complete and fully acquitted and demonstrates some incredible impact for so many primary school children and their families over the 2024 academic year across WA and NT.
Smiling Child funding is available to Aboriginal and Non-Aboriginal Children. In fact, this year 80% of the children who benefited from the funding were Non-Aboriginal, in schools across Perth Metro, WA Regional and Darwin.
Whilst the charts below show how the funding was spent, benefitting 653 children in total, it’s the feedback we receive which we really look forward to. The following is a snapshot of just some of the feedback we received.
“The grant funding has a transformative impact on our school community, enabling the subsidisation of essential programs by reducing the costs associated with swimming lessons, textbooks, Year 6 camp attendance, Year 6 Leavers’ clothing, and participation in Schools Go Dance. The funding ensures that all students can access vital learning opportunities, personal development experiences, and the joy of milestone celebrations, regardless of financial circumstances.”
“Multiple parents extremely grateful for funding, particularly for swimming lessons. At least two families have Grandparents as the main carers (one of those has 6 children living in the house), who would not have been able to support the swimming. We had one Grandmother in tears with thanks. We have several of the students with 100% attendance for the swimming lesson period as they were so excited to be able to go.”
“It was great to see that all of our students could participate in swimming lessons this year. This hasn’t happened in a long time.”
“I appreciate the support. With four kids, swimming lessons isn’t something I can normally afford.”
“I love swimming lessons!” one student responded when asked how they felt about being able to do swimming lessons.
